Last one for tonight is the Berlin apartment, a tiny bit loose feeling on controller but adore what the team is going for and this walk through history via renovating an apartment on the east/west line of Berlin through its many storied tenants is such a cool concept

Subversive memories next up on the docket! The ambiance was cool and setting the game in the height of some political unrest in brazil is a neat start for something that wears its love for classics like resident evil on its sleeve. Retro early ps1 vibes and you can see the early puzzle threads.

Side effects is a cool take in competitive dying genre that cropped up with shotgun roulette and I think the flesh muppet aesthetic it has going rounds out how disgusting but engaging these kinds of games have become.
